ColdFusion "Содержание не разрешено в прологе" XML без Bom - PullRequest
0 голосов
/ 26 июня 2011

У меня возникли проблемы с анализом XML-файла с помощью ColdFusion.Я дважды проверил файл спецификации для спецификации, который не существует.

Поворот, код происходит только тогда, когда я использую <cfinvoke>.Итак, на index.cfm

<cfinvoke component='controller.me' method='ADQuery'>
</cfinvoke>

Controller / Me.cfc

<cffunction name='ADQuery' output='true'>
<cfset netinfoxml = XMLParse(ExpandPath('conf/netinfo.xml'))>

Тогда все идет не так.Тем не менее, если я сделаю это прямо из index.cfm, и дам его.Тогда все хорошо.

Есть идеи?

Извините, это, наверное, что-то невероятно тривиальное

1 Ответ

0 голосов
/ 26 июня 2011

может быть, это поможет, кажется, довольно подробное описание [и решение!] Вашей проблемы ....

http://www.bennadel.com/blog/1206-Content-Is-Not-Allowed-In-Prolog-ColdFusion-XML-And-The-Byte-Order-Mark-BOM-.htm

Если нет, можете ли вы опубликовать xml?

-sean

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...